Instead of taking a trip over the river and through the woods, you can now take a virtual tour of Santa's home. This home according to Zillow is a state-of-the-art toy-making facility with workstations for 50 craftsmen. The home was built in 1822, comes with a sleigh garage, stables that board eight live-in reindeer, plus a bonus stall for red-nosed company.

A toy-lover's paradise nestled on 25 idyllic acres at the North Pole – perfect for spirited reindeer games. The home, constructed in the 1800s of gorgeous old-growth timber logged on site, is steeped in Old World charm but offers modern-day amenities, thanks to a 2013 renovation. A welcoming entryway leads to the living room with a floor-to-ceiling river rock fireplace for roasting chestnuts. The gourmet kitchen is a baker's dream, boasting an oven with 12 different cookie settings. Cookies are served directly from oven to table in the adjoining dining room."

 

According to Zillow, the home is currently off the market. It could fetch for over $656,000 if Santa ever sells it. Photos in our video are from Zillow.
